Western blot - HRP Anti-Fatty Acid Synthase antibody [EPR7466] (AB196854)

ab196854 was shown to specifically react with Fatty Acid Synthase in wild-type HAP1 cells as signal was lost in FASN (Fatty Acid Synthase) knockout cells. Wild-type and FASN (Fatty Acid Synthase) knockout samples were subjected to SDS-PAGE. ab196854 and ab184095 (Mouse monoclonal [mAbcam 9484] to GAPDH - Loading Control (Alexa Fluor® 680) loading control) were incubated overnight at 4°C at 1/5000 dilution and 1/1000 dilution respectively. The loading control was imaged using the Licor Odyssey CLx prior to blots being developed with ECL technique.

Western blot - HRP Anti-Fatty Acid Synthase antibody [EPR7466] (AB196854)

This blot was produced using a 3-8% Tris Acetate gel under the TA buffer system. The gel was run at 150V for 60 minutes before being transferred onto a Nitrocellulose membrane at 30V for 70 minutes. The membrane was then blocked for an hour using 2% Bovine Serum Albumin before being incubated with ab196854 overnight at 4°C. Antibody binding was visualised using ECL development solution ab133406.

Target data

Fatty acid synthetase is a multifunctional enzyme that catalyzes the de novo biosynthesis of long-chain saturated fatty acids starting from acetyl-CoA and malonyl-CoA in the presence of NADPH. This multifunctional protein contains 7 catalytic activities and a site for the binding of the prosthetic group 4'-phosphopantetheine of the acyl carrier protein ([ACP]) domain.. (Microbial infection) Fatty acid synthetase activity is required for SARS coronavirus-2/SARS-CoV-2 replication.
